Lectures:
1. Classification of intelligent systems according to control method
2. Classification of wiring standards and intelligent wiring by manufacturers
3. Tecomat Foxtrot system for smart buildings and smart cities
4. Possible structures of the Tecomat Foxtrot system.
5. Lighting control and other technologies in buildings - part 1.
6. Lighting control and other building technologies - part 2.
7. Control of HVAC units.
8. Energy metering using the Foxtrot system.
9. Irrigation and flooding, metering using the Foxtrot system.
10. Indoor climate control (heating/cooling/ventilation) and shading control using Foxtrot.
11. Temperature sensors and controllers, Foxtrot control modules.
12. Energy management of the point of use using the Foxtrot system.
13. Security systems EZS, EPS and access control systems Foxtrot.

Project:
1. Design of bus wiring in a family house using Tecomat Foxtrot bus system.
2. Creation of a program in the Mosaic development software to control the bus wiring in a family house using the Tecomat Foxtrot system.
